Address 0 PPC

PLNvD2Fg7fipykBiPMUd8ykksVN2bQVKmQ

Confirmed

Total Received1.80959 PPC
Total Sent1.80959 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PTWTvzvWwF4jhNQnuXHrurACxu48j8E8z241.1285 PPC
PLNvD2Fg7fipykBiPMUd8ykksVN2bQVKmQ1.80959 PPC
Fee: 0.00191 PPC
139161 Confirmations42.93809 PPC